Press release from the Montgomery County Department of Police:
April 19, 2022
UPDATE: The child has been reunited with his parents.
____________________________________________________________________________
Gaithersburg, MD - Officers from the Montgomery County Police Department 6th District Station are asking for the public's assistance in locating the parents or guardians of a child located in the area of Whetstone Elementary School on Thomas Farm Road in Gaithersburg at approximately 10 a.m. on April 19, 2022.
The child appears to be a Hispanic male, two to four-years old. He is wearing a blue and white knit cap, light grey hooded sweatshirt, dark grey t-shirt, black pants, and black shoes. He is approximately three feet tall.
Anyone with information on the whereabouts of this child's parents or guardians is asked to call the police non-emergency number at 301-279-8000 (24-hour line) or the Montgomery County Police 6th District Station at 240-773-5700.
